WebThe pharmacokinetic properties of phen azopyridine have not been fully el ucidated. Phenazopyridine and its metabolites are rapidly excreted by the kidneys. In a small number of healthy subjects, 90% of a 600 mg/day oral dose of phenazopyridine was eliminated in the urine in 24 hours, 41% as unchanged drug and 49% as metabolites. WebPhenazopyridine is metabolized in the liver, and acetaminophen has been discovered to be one metabolite of this drug. 15 Hydroxylation is a pathway by which this drug is …

WebApr 1, 2024 · Phenazopyridine (PhP) is a DESI drug widely prescribed for the symptomatic relief of pain, burning, urgency, and frequency related to lower urinary tract infections. PhP is believed to exert its analgesic effect on the urinary tract mucosa, however, the exact active metabolite contributing to efficacy remains unclear. WebJan 18, 2024 · Phenazopyridine Hydrochloride: Headache, rash and occasional gastrointestinal disturbance. An anaphylactoid-like reaction has been described. WebJun 7, 2024 · Small, trace quantities of phenazopyridine are thought to cross the placenta and the blood-brain barrier, reaching cerebrospinal fluid. A pharmacokinetic study in rats determined that phenazopyridine metabolites were present in high levels in the kidney and liver.
